Default NVIDIA GeForce 9800 GTX+ 512MB Benchmarked

I started a term when the 9800 GTX was first released known as YANL: Yet Another NVIDIA Launch. Basically it's a derogatory term poking fun at a company that produces a LOT of different brands and products; some with very little separating them from a technical perspective.

Yesterday news started leaking about a new GPU from NVIDIA called the GeForce 9800 GTX+ - essentially an overclocked G92 part built on a new 55nm process technology that will sell at a LOWER price than current 9800 GTX cards on the market. Interested yet?
